    Insane Boats P-Spec Sport Hydro 1st run with Vid !!!

    First let me say what an honor it was for me to be selected by Jeff Michaud, owner of Insane Boats to be the rigger/tester/owner of the first P-Spec rigged boat. And man, it's beautifull - absolutely the finest piece of craftmanship I've ever seen in a FE boat - both the hull and hardware. Out on the course she just ripped, and I backed off in the turns, as was my habit with other boats. Jeff said :
    " Just hold her wide open" and I did just that and she took the turns WFO like she was on rails. [I'd forgotten that when I run with Jeff's gassers they just rip up the turns wide open, and this boat was designed by Jeff to do just that !}

    Setup : Ul-1 motor [ a workhorse I made from 2 kaboshed UL-1 motors]
    ( a fresh one should add more mph I suspect )
    UL-1 speed control, servo, and Tx/Rx
    .150 flex
    Hyperion 2S 5000's in series[ Loaned by UBHauled-thanks Bro] (incorrectly identified in the vid as 2S2P
    ABC H-5 trimmed to 44.79 mm plus some Sholund magic

    GPS : 53.6 MPH
